Randy “Pop” Cornelius, 78, a resident of Andalusia, and formerly of Luverne, passed away peacefully on Wednesday, Dec. 13, 2023, at Andalusia Health.

A celebration of Randy’s life will be held Sunday, Dec. 17, 3 p.m., at Luverne Church of Christ with Chap. Josh Kiser officiating and Bro. Stae Sanders delivering the eulogy.

Randy proudly served his country with the United States Navy right after high school. He enjoyed his time in the service, especially when he was stationed in Hawaii. After he was honorably discharged, Randy returned home and went to school to earn his barber’s license. He spent the rest of his working career cutting hair, primarily in Luverne and then opened his own business in Andalusia. He had a gift for gab, which served him extremely well in his chosen occupation. Randy was one of the few who could honestly say that he woke up every day looking forward to his day at work. He took great care of his customers and had a loyal contingent for decades. He loved spending his day discussing the “news” (because, you know, men do not gossip!) with his clients and left them feeling better when they walked out to carry on with their day. Randy knew how fortunate he was to love what he did for a living and that meant so much to him throughout his life.

In his free time, Randy was an avid outdoorsman. He loved any activity that kept him out in the beauty of nature, whether it was fishing or hunting. He could use either a gun or a bow when he was hunting, and you had better be a dedicated hunter if you were going to go with him. Hunting was serious business for Randy, to the point that you better get out of the area if you wanted to eat something, and don’t come back smelling like whatever you ate! However, there was nothing he loved more than his family. He was a dedicated son as he took such tender care of his mother in her last years, and he was a truly devoted husband, father, and grandfather. He adored his children, but the best thing they ever did was make him “Pop” to a bevy of grandchildren. Those grandchildren thrived under his love and generous heart, and cherished every moment they were able to spend together.
